**Summary of Position**:
The Health Navigator is designed to work directly with and on behalf of indigent, homeless, and uninsured patients who present frequently, and often for inappropriate healthcare needs, at local Emergency Departments with whom Circle the City has formal partnerships. The goal of the Health Navigator is to end the inappropriate overuse of emergency rooms and inpatient hospitalization by chronically homeless individuals who are medically vulnerable and to assist them with their benefits, identification of a medical home at Circle the City and to work collaboratively with community partners for shelter, benefits, and housing assessment and placement. The Health Navigator is co-located within partner Emergency Departments and works with hospital clinical and social work staff to identify, screen, and refer these high-utilizing patients to more appropriate and less costly medical settings at CTC.

**Essential duties**:
**Duties include, but are not limited to**:

- Outreach and Consumer Identification: Engage chronically homeless, medically needy adults who are frequent users of hospital and emergency services annually.
- Assessment and Planning: Will develop an individualized plan to move these individuals from an emergency care model to a preventative primary care model.
- Direct Service Provision and Intervention to include:

- Initiate transition of care into Circle the City's Respite Centers.
- Ensure all referral medical records are uploaded into NaviHealth and available for our Respite Intake Team.
- Communicate status of the referral to your Case Management Team and report progress.
- Ensure patients have their medication lists upon discharge.
- Arrange transportation from the hospital to our Respite Center.
- Work directly with shelter services to ensure the patient has a coordinated entry into shelter services and a reserved bed waiting for them upon discharge.
- Assist patients in scheduling post discharge appointments and ensure any barriers to care are addressed prior to discharge.
- Address the patient/resident as a whole, including all social factors related to chronic health issues.
- Move homeless individuals into respite care, and stable permanent housing.
- Plan for health assessment and identification of health needs/plan of action. Establish primary care provider, targeted Health Education, maintain AHCCCS/health care enrollment.
- Access and coordinate inpatient and outpatient mental health/substance use treatment services as needed.
- Participate in multi-disciplinary team meetings as needed to coordinate patient services and review accomplishments.
